If you are planning on FI actually I would do the following:

1. lurk in the FI section of this forum. lots of dudes made lots of power and lots of mistakes that hopefully you can avoid.

2. build an educated list of things you want to get before buying things: example...You will wind up replacing that HKS exhaust for a 3" exhaust when you stick it on the dyno for the first time. The CAI is a total waste of cash IMO, if you are going FI. Pretty much everything that you just listed other than the spacer you will end up replacing after you've bought your super/turbo charger and stuck it on the dyno.

THINK before modding my friend. I usually think about the mods Im going to be getting months or YEARS before I actually purchase them. Make sure you know what you are doing before you start throwing cash out the window.
